Offenbach’s Les Contes d’Hoffmann
Benjamin Bernheim headlines as the tormented poet Hoffmann, opposite a star trio of lovers: Erin Morley as Olympia, Pretty Yende as Antonia, and Clémentine Margaine as Giulietta. Marco Armiliato conducts a cast that also features Christian Van Horn as the Four Villains and Vasilisa Berzhanskaya as Nicklausse.

Jeanine Tesori’s Grounded
LIBRETTO BY GEORGE BRANT
Emily D’Angelo stars as a female fighter pilot turned Reaper drone operator balancing the pressures of combat, romance, and motherhood. Yannick Nézet-Séguin takes the podium for Michael Mayer's Met premiere production.

Puccini’s Tosca
Aleksandra Kurzak reprises her riveting portrayal of the title role, starring alongside SeokJong Baek as her revolutionary lover, Cavaradossi, and George Gagnidze as the sadistic chief of police, Scarpia. Xian Zhang conducts.
